溫馨提示×

如何確保sql event的穩定性

sql
小樊
86
2024-09-15 07:39:22
欄目: 云計算

要確保SQL事件的穩定性,可以采取以下措施:

  1. 選擇合適的數據庫管理系統(DBMS):選擇一個成熟、穩定且具有良好支持的DBMS,如MySQL、PostgreSQL或Microsoft SQL Server等。

  2. 數據庫設計和規范化:遵循數據庫設計原則,例如規范化,以消除數據冗余和提高數據完整性。這將有助于確保數據庫結構的穩定性。

  3. 使用事務處理:在需要保持數據一致性的操作中使用事務處理,例如插入、更新或刪除數據時。事務處理可確保操作的原子性、一致性、隔離性和持久性(ACID屬性)。

  4. 錯誤處理和日志記錄:實現錯誤處理機制,以便在出現問題時能夠快速定位并解決問題。同時,記錄詳細的日志,以便在出現問題時進行分析和調試。

  5. 索引優化:為經常查詢的列創建索引,以提高查詢性能。但請注意,過多的索引可能會影響插入和更新操作的性能。因此,需要權衡索引的數量和性能。

  6. 定期維護和備份:定期對數據庫進行維護,例如更新統計信息、重建索引等,以確保數據庫性能穩定。同時,定期備份數據庫,以防止數據丟失。

  7. 監控和性能調優:使用監控工具來監控數據庫的性能指標,例如CPU使用率、內存使用情況、磁盤I/O等。根據監控結果,對數據庫進行性能調優。

  8. 安全性:確保數據庫的安全性,包括限制訪問權限、加密敏感數據、防止SQL注入等。

  9. 定期審查和更新:定期審查數據庫設計和應用程序代碼,以確保它們符合最佳實踐和安全標準。同時,及時更新DBMS軟件,以修復已知的安全漏洞和性能問題。

通過遵循上述建議,可以確保SQL事件的穩定性,從而提高應用程序的性能和可靠性。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女